Indian-Origin Man Admits Manslaughter in Wife's Australia Death, Denies Murder

  • Vikrant Thakur, 42, an Indian-origin man, admitted responsibility for his wife Supriya Thakur's death in Australia.
  • He pleaded guilty to manslaughter but denied the charge of murder in the Adelaide Magistrates Court.
  • Supriya Thakur, 36, was found unconscious at their Adelaide home on December 21 and could not be revived.
  • Prosecutors requested a 16-week adjournment for key evidence, including DNA analysis and the post-mortem report.
  • A GoFundMe fundraiser has been launched by friends and the community to support Supriya's young son.
